We compared two Desktop platform GPUs: 1024MB VRAM GeForce GT 140 OEM and 6GB VRAM GeForce RTX 4050 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
NVIDIA GeForce RTX 4050 's Advantages
Boost Clock2640MHz
More VRAM (6GB vs 1GB)
Larger VRAM bandwidth (216.0GB/s vs 57.60GB/s)
2496 additional rendering cores
Lower TDP (100W vs 105W)
